What is Desonide?

Desonide is a low-potency topical corticosteroid (steroid) used on the skin to reduce inflammation. It helps relieve redness, swelling, itching, and irritation caused by certain skin conditions.

It is commonly prescribed for:

* Atopic dermatitis (eczema)

* Contact dermatitis

* Allergic skin reactions

* Mild psoriasis

* Skin irritation in sensitive areas

Desonide is considered milder than many other topical steroids and is often used on delicate skin areas when appropriate.

How Desonide Works

Desonide works by calming the immune response in the skin.

In inflammatory skin conditions, the immune system releases chemicals that cause:

* Redness

* Swelling

* Itching

* Rash

Desonide reduces the production of these inflammatory substances. This helps improve symptoms and comfort.

It manages flare-ups but does not cure chronic skin conditions such as eczema. Symptoms may return after stopping treatment.

Side Effects of Desonide

Common Side Effects

* Mild burning or stinging

* Skin dryness

* Irritation

* Redness

These are usually temporary.

Serious Side Effects (Rare)

* Skin thinning

* Stretch marks

* Skin discoloration

* Increased hair growth at application site

* Worsening of skin infection

Seek medical attention if you notice:

* Severe irritation

* Signs of infection (pus, spreading redness, fever)

* Unusual skin changes

Using the lowest effective dose reduces risk.

Safety & Important Considerations

Children

Children absorb topical steroids more easily through the skin. Use only as prescribed and for limited durations.

Sensitive Areas

Use caution on:

* Face

* Groin

* Underarms

Long-term use in these areas increases risk of skin thinning.

Pregnancy and Breastfeeding

Use only if recommended by a licensed medical specialist. Apply minimal amounts. Avoid application to the breast area during breastfeeding unless directed.

Skin Infections

Do not use on untreated bacterial, fungal, or viral skin infections unless advised.

Regular follow-up may be needed for long-term conditions.

Alternatives to Desonide

Other treatment options may include:

* Other low-potency topical corticosteroids

* Medium-potency topical steroids

* Topical calcineurin inhibitors

*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ory creams

* Moisturizers and barrier repair products

Treatment choice depends on diagnosis, severity, and patient age. Changes should only be made after consultation with a dermatologist.
